【必收藏】零代码开发新应用:小白也能掌握的AI开发全流程
本文详细介绍了利用AI助手(如Codex、ChatGPT)进行零代码开发应用程序的完整工作流。文章以开发简约日程软件为例,阐述了从确定需求与技术栈、规划与Spec、开发与调试到测试与发布的四个关键步骤。特别强调在AI时代,开发者应专注于培养"解决思路"和"宏观架构设计能力",而非单纯编码技术。同时提醒开发者需了解AI Agent的基础知识,如上下文管理和盲区识别,以有效驾驭AI开发工具,提高开发效
本期只是一个简要版 AI 的开发工作流,旨在让新手入门的时候可以明白 AI 开发究竟是怎么回事,以及怎么保证 AI “不乱搞”。近期 Claude 之父提出的“代码生成工作流”特别火,感兴趣的朋友也可以自行搜索相关资料阅读。
在本期内容中,我将会以 Codex 为例,介绍如何从零开始构建自己的第一个应用程序。至于 Claude Code 怎么用,各大 AI IDE(如 Cursor、Trae 等)怎么用,其实都是触类旁通的。在 Codex 中,我们通过终端界面与 AI 进行对话;而在 IDE 中则变成了图形化界面(类似 Cursor 的好处是非常方便引用各种文本和文件内容,对小白尤为友好)。
本期我们会以一个简约的日程软件为例。为了便于理解,我们选择在 Windows 系统下进行网页版的演示。这虽然并非一个真实商业应用,但开发的工作流是被完全复用的。按照这套思路,你花一天时间可能开发出一个 Demo,花一周时间可能就是一个 MVP(最小可行性产品)了。
零代码构建应用的工作流
这里,我将为大家梳理构建任何一款应用所需要的通用工作流:
- 确定需求与技术栈
- 规划 Spec(需求规范)
- 开发与调试
- 后续部署与迭代
第一部分:确定需求和技术栈
首先,我们要明确一个根本问题:自己到底要开发什么?
这是一个在哪里运行的应用?是手机 App 还是电脑软件?核心代码是运行在本地浏览器还是云端服务器?关于这些问题,在 2026 年的今天,如果你不懂,千万别去疯狂搜索查资料,直接问 AI。
使用任何一款 AI 聊天软件,用大白话描述清楚自己的需求、想做出一款在什么场景下使用的应用,AI 就能端出对应的方案。例如,我们要帮自己做一个简约的日历软件,就需要知道它怎么用。
我们假设想在 Windows 系统下的网页浏览器里直接使用。那么就可以直接让 AI 充当向导。我们不需要一次性问完,和 AI 的互动类似于“和技术专家的午餐会”,不需要特别严谨,以达成任务目标为最终目的。甚至,连问 AI 的提示词(Prompt),你都可以交由 AI 先帮你写。为了方便起见,我这里直接一步到位,让 ChatGPT 一次性把需求和技术栈都给确定下来。
例如,你可以直接在任何一个 AI 聊天机器人对话框里(如 ChatGPT、Claude、Gemini 或者国产的千问、豆包等,根据个人喜好)输入如下提示词:
我是一个完全不懂写代码的新手小白,但我现在想借助 AI,自己动手开发一款简约的“日常日程日历”软件。
我希望这个软件能直接在我的 Windows 电脑浏览器里打开使用,不需要去花钱租服务器,也不希望去安装复杂的编程环境。 需要的功能很简单:能展示一个月历视图,点击某一天能添加、修改和删除日程提醒。
请问:
要实现这个目标,我第一步应该做什么?
针对纯小白,你推荐我使用什么样的技术方案(技术栈)?不用太复杂,能在浏览器里跑起来就行。
请充当我的产品经理兼技术导师,用通俗易懂的语言帮我梳理一下接下来的完整开发框架!
(注:如果你还未明确需求和技术栈,使用网页版的聊天机器人进行这种大量的“摸索性和框架性对话”会比直接在代码终端里问更方便。)
对于 AI 的回答,如果你看不懂,请尽情地反复追问。真实的开发中,我们和 AI 就是随意聊天的。比如 AI 告诉你用前端(HTML、CSS、JS)就行了,如果你不知道这些是啥,就让 AI 当你的老师,给你打比方,直到你理解它们分别承担什么角色为止。
记住,你不需要吃透每一个技术细节,只要知道它们能干嘛就行了。例如,你只需要知道 HTML 是用来搭网页骨架的,CSS 是用来“化妆”美化网页的,JS 是用来写网页动态交互的,这就足够了。至于它们内部怎么衔接、怎么闭合标签,那是 AI Agent 的事情。
既然这些繁琐的编码都是 Agent 的事情,那我们有必要了解得这么细致吗?
极其有必要。因为我们需要对项目具备“宏观掌控权”。如果不清楚各个部件的边界,当 AI 迭代执行的轮次越来越多时,系统就有可能陷入混乱,出现失控的局面(这一点我们在下文的“基础知识”里会详细讲)。
回到刚才的例子中,AI 会给我们返回一套长篇大论的方案。由于篇幅限制,我只截取最核心的部分。
首先,AI 会帮我们梳理这个项目的需求边界:

接着,AI 为我们推荐了对于小白最友好的技术栈:

接下来,你只要把回答里看不懂的名词让 AI 解释清楚,最终聊出一套拍板的方案,就可以进入下一步了。
第二部分:规划与 Spec
明确了要做什么,我们就要用上 AI Agent 开发工具了。这里我使用的是 Codex(你也可以用 Cursor 等)。至于 Codex 如何安装,只要你的电脑上有 Node.js 环境,在终端里运行一行极其简单的命令即可安装:
npm install -g @openai/codex-cli
注:不同时期工具名称或安装方式可能略有变化。如果你报错了,或者压根不懂什么是 Node.js,请直接把报错信息截图甩给 AI 聊天机器人,让它手把手教你解决一切环境问题。
我们在本地新建一个空文件夹(作为你的项目根目录)。在这个文件夹里打开终端(小白可以询问 AI 怎么打开当前文件夹的终端),输入 codex,即可进入 Codex 的交互界面(如果中途询问是否信任该目录,选“是”)。此时你就唤醒了你的专属本地 Agent!
在开工前,你可以直接和 Codex 聊天,把刚才和网页端 AI 聊完后拍板的想法发给 Codex,并下达指令:“请在本地根目录创建一个项目规划文档(比如spec.md或者plan.md),把这些需求和技术栈记录下来。”你也可以自己把网页端生成的规划保存到本地文件中,然后在 Codex 里面通过 @spec.md 或者文件路径引用的方式告诉 AI:“照着这个计划执行。”

在让 Agent 放飞自我写代码之前,有一点小技巧:你可以使用 /permission 命令(或其他等效授权命令)来调整允许 Agent 自动执行的操作权限。这能省去它每次修改文件都要问你“是否同意”的麻烦,避免每次都需要手动允许。
此处,我把 ChatGPT 生成的提示词直接发给 Codex,让它撰写出项目的实施规划文档:

文档撰写结束后,你应当打开它看一眼。如果不满意,可以直接在规划文档里进行手工修改,或者用大白话跟 Codex 说:“日历还要加上农历显示,去修改规划文档。”直至你觉得万事俱备,就可以使用自然语言让 Codex 开始按照计划执行开发。
第三部分:开发与调试

一旦 Codex 开始执行计划,你会看到终端里飞速滚动的日志。接下来就等待计划完成即可。执行完毕后的效果如下(这是仅用一次提示、一次规划,未做任何人工干预和调试的输出效果):


这是一个五脏俱全且颜值尚可的前端 Demo!相信沿着这个思路,任何人都能零敲碎打地做出自己的第一个应用。正是因为这完全是由 AI 极速生成的,就不在此占篇幅贴源码了。
Codex 甚至还非常贴心地在最后给出了运行说明:
如何运行 1. 将 index.html、style.css、app.js 放到同一个文件夹。 2. 双击 index.html(或右键用 Chrome/Edge 打开)。 3. 点击日期即可新增/编辑/删除日程,数据会自动保存在 localStorage 中。
如果在运行中遇到 Bug 怎么办?直接将报错截图或你看到的不符合预期的地方描述给 Codex,它会自动去排查代码并修复。
另外,前端开发由于往往需要查看和调试网页,目前很多 AI IDE 甚至具备了直接操作浏览器的能力。比如谷歌的 Antigravity 就在内部集成了 Chrome 浏览器自动化能力,Agent 弄完代码后,不仅能自主打开页面查验效果,遇到报错它会自动看 Console 日志继续回头改代码,直到调试通过为止。
环境安装的“代理代理人”思维以后你要是开发 Python 或者 Java 后端应用,少不了和包管理工具(如 pip)、虚拟环境创建打交道。以往新手在这块往往会被各种环境配置报错折磨到放弃。 而在 AI 时代,你可以直接让 AI Agent 帮你装!由于它拥有执行终端命令的权限,它会替你执行所有的安装命令。当然,为了不在日后一头雾水,建议你在让它装完后问一句:“你刚才执行的这条安装命令是干什么的?”——遇到不懂的全都甩给 AI 去干,但我们要借机把思路学过来,这就是零代码时代最高效的学习法。
重申:思路大过技术关于后端应用怎么挂载、各个服务怎么通讯、架构怎么选型,这些知识你可以随着用 AI 做项目慢慢积累。在这里想再次提醒大家:AI 时代,我们学习的不再是单纯的敲码技术,而是“解决思路”和“宏观架构设计的能力”。你需要拥有全局观。你要像产品经理、甚至像老板一样思考问题。在这个时代,每一个会用 AI 工具的普通人都是一名运筹帷幄的“大导演”,你需要统筹整场戏的流程;而 AI 只是不知疲倦的“天才演员库”,负责把你的剧本一秒不差地演出来。
第四部分:后续测试与发布
如果你的软件不是简单的 Demo,而是要交付给别人实际使用的,那么在完成基本功能后,你还需要面临更复杂的阶段:软件的测试部署与打包上线。
真实的软件开发并非一招鲜吃遍天,而是需要根据实际情况灵活应变。假设你做的是个网页应用,那么让 AI 帮你写个 Vercel 或 GitHub Pages 的配置文件,一分钟就能免费挂到公网上;但如果你要做一个能上架苹果商店的 iOS 手机应用,那就会涉及打包编译、开发者证书签名等一系列更严苛的规则。
不要慌,这些看似超出小白认知的专业工作,今天统统也可以纳入到你与 AI 的开发工作流当中。你可以让 Agent 帮你生成各类繁琐的自动化部署脚本,遇到打包失败,直接让它分析长长的 Error Log 找出病灶。Agent 将帮你避开大量的重复踩坑时间,让我们能更加聚焦在产品核心业务的打磨上。关于项目实战的深度打包上线,我们在后续的内容里会有更多的探讨。
必须要懂的 Agent 基础知识
在彻底放飞自我之前,作为“导演”,你必须弄懂手下这个“AI 演员”的局限性与工作原理。否则,只要项目体积稍微一大,你就会面临频频翻车的失控局面。
- 什么是上下文(Context)?满了怎么办? AI 的“短期记忆”是存在物理上限的,俗称“上下文窗口”。这就决定了它不可能同时把你硬盘里几百个不相干的代码文件全部记在脑子里去思考问题。 如果上下文爆了(超出了它的记忆上限),你的 AI 就会开始“精神涣散”、胡言乱语或者频繁遗漏你刚提过的需求。学会管理上下文,是你驾驭 AI 的必修课。 比如,通过 /compact 命令让它把刚才几十轮冗长废话压缩成总结摘要;或者,在一个具体任务完成后,新建一个干干净净的对话框(新起一个 Context),只丢给它当前需要修改的文件,不要让以前的聊天记录污染它的大脑。
- 警惕 AI 的盲区:永远提供有效引导 “眼见不一定为实。”因为 AI 只能按照它的视野来做事。如果你电脑的网络断了导致程序跑不通,而 AI 却只能在代码文件里死磕,它就会不停地删改正确的代码,陷入“鬼打墙”。 **解决办法:**作为项目的超级管理员,一旦发现 AI 陷入死循环的“钻牛角尖”,你必须立刻介入,下发新的引导指令进行纠偏。比如告诉它:“先别改代码了,去终端 ping 一下远程服务器,看看是不是网络不通。”
- AI Agent 到底是怎样做到“自己敲键盘”的? 你可能会觉得不可思议:凭什么我在网页跟 ChatGPT 聊天它只会吐出文字,而本地运行的 Codex 却能新建文件、自己运行终端程序? 其实所有的极客魔法,都源于底层的一个核心功能:工具调用(Tool Calling)。开发者给大模型开放了一系列受控的机器权限操作接口(比如 read_file, write_to_file, execute_bash)。当大模型思考后得出结论“我需要创建一个 CSS 文件”,它就会通过特定的 JSON 格式向你的电脑发出请求,由宿主程序代为执行文件创建。正是因为它有了操作你文件系统的权限,所以我们才要一再强调权限控制的重要性。
关于 Agent 的运转机理其实深不见底,但学完这一篇,你大脑中对 AI 编程认知模型的框架已经立了起来。
对于那些巨型复杂项目,我们需要更加透彻地理解 Agent 的各种进阶特性,这才是我们在 AI 时代看清未来发展之路的根本。在接下来的专栏更新中,我将带大家持续进行 AI Agent 的硬核深度拆解。我会剥开外壳,带你一步步看懂市面上主流 Agent 的底层架构设计、行为逻辑闭环以及记忆管理机制,让你真正搞懂“它是怎么思考和干活的”。
普通人如何抓住AI大模型的风口?
领取方式在文末
为什么要学习大模型?
目前AI大模型的技术岗位与能力培养随着人工智能技术的迅速发展和应用 , 大模型作为其中的重要组成部分 , 正逐渐成为推动人工智能发展的重要引擎 。大模型以其强大的数据处理和模式识别能力, 广泛应用于自然语言处理 、计算机视觉 、 智能推荐等领域 ,为各行各业带来了革命性的改变和机遇 。
目前,开源人工智能大模型已应用于医疗、政务、法律、汽车、娱乐、金融、互联网、教育、制造业、企业服务等多个场景,其中,应用于金融、企业服务、制造业和法律领域的大模型在本次调研中占比超过 30%。
随着AI大模型技术的迅速发展,相关岗位的需求也日益增加。大模型产业链催生了一批高薪新职业:
人工智能大潮已来,不加入就可能被淘汰。如果你是技术人,尤其是互联网从业者,现在就开始学习AI大模型技术,真的是给你的人生一个重要建议!
最后
只要你真心想学习AI大模型技术,这份精心整理的学习资料我愿意无偿分享给你,但是想学技术去乱搞的人别来找我!
在当前这个人工智能高速发展的时代,AI大模型正在深刻改变各行各业。我国对高水平AI人才的需求也日益增长,真正懂技术、能落地的人才依旧紧缺。我也希望通过这份资料,能够帮助更多有志于AI领域的朋友入门并深入学习。
真诚无偿分享!!!
vx扫描下方二维码即可
加上后会一个个给大家发
【附赠一节免费的直播讲座,技术大佬带你学习大模型的相关知识、学习思路、就业前景以及怎么结合当前的工作发展方向等,欢迎大家~】
大模型全套学习资料展示
自我们与MoPaaS魔泊云合作以来,我们不断打磨课程体系与技术内容,在细节上精益求精,同时在技术层面也新增了许多前沿且实用的内容,力求为大家带来更系统、更实战、更落地的大模型学习体验。

希望这份系统、实用的大模型学习路径,能够帮助你从零入门,进阶到实战,真正掌握AI时代的核心技能!
01 教学内容

-
从零到精通完整闭环:【基础理论 →RAG开发 → Agent设计 → 模型微调与私有化部署调→热门技术】5大模块,内容比传统教材更贴近企业实战!
-
大量真实项目案例: 带你亲自上手搞数据清洗、模型调优这些硬核操作,把课本知识变成真本事!
02适学人群
应届毕业生: 无工作经验但想要系统学习AI大模型技术,期待通过实战项目掌握核心技术。
零基础转型: 非技术背景但关注AI应用场景,计划通过低代码工具实现“AI+行业”跨界。
业务赋能突破瓶颈: 传统开发者(Java/前端等)学习Transformer架构与LangChain框架,向AI全栈工程师转型。

vx扫描下方二维码即可
【附赠一节免费的直播讲座,技术大佬带你学习大模型的相关知识、学习思路、就业前景以及怎么结合当前的工作发展方向等,欢迎大家~】
本教程比较珍贵,仅限大家自行学习,不要传播!更严禁商用!
03 入门到进阶学习路线图
大模型学习路线图,整体分为5个大的阶段:
04 视频和书籍PDF合集

从0到掌握主流大模型技术视频教程(涵盖模型训练、微调、RAG、LangChain、Agent开发等实战方向)

新手必备的大模型学习PDF书单来了!全是硬核知识,帮你少走弯路(不吹牛,真有用)
05 行业报告+白皮书合集
收集70+报告与白皮书,了解行业最新动态!
06 90+份面试题/经验
AI大模型岗位面试经验总结(谁学技术不是为了赚$呢,找个好的岗位很重要)

07 deepseek部署包+技巧大全

由于篇幅有限
只展示部分资料
并且还在持续更新中…
真诚无偿分享!!!
vx扫描下方二维码即可
加上后会一个个给大家发
【附赠一节免费的直播讲座,技术大佬带你学习大模型的相关知识、学习思路、就业前景以及怎么结合当前的工作发展方向等,欢迎大家~】
更多推荐



所有评论(0)